Phosphatidate cytidylyltransferase - Wikipedia
WebPhosphatidate cytidylyltransferase ( EC 2.7.7.41) [1] [2] [3] (also known as CDP- diacylglycerol synthase) (CDS) is the enzyme that catalyzes the synthesis of CDP-diacylglycerol from cytidine triphosphate and phosphatidate . CTP + phosphatidate diphosphate + CDP-diacylglycerol Besides de novo synthesis, PA can be formed in three ways: By phospholipase D (PLD), via the hydrolysis of the P-O bond of phosphatidylcholine (PC) to produce PA and choline.
